Doug Clark (Guitar, Vocals) has been in and out of mental institutions, and with good reason. (From what I've heard, anyway)
Original vox-man Ron Reckless is a whole seperate set of tumultuous rumours and varied psychoses.
I'll never forget when I first heard Mental Mansion back in the day;
...it was like all my spooky childhood fantasies and nightmares all rolled into one creepy-ass song.
Cool Fact:
Their second release,
The New Manson Family
was produced by none other than the Godfather of Spooks Himself, Alice Cooper
(Actually, This "Cool Fact" is a debated issue; it just kinda looks cool...)

Recommended:
1. Mighty Sphincter - Ghost Walking/ Waltz In Hell E.P.
2. The New Manson Family (pictured below)
3. In the Kingdom Of Heaven
4. The Holy Unholy

Greg Hynes has advised me of an upcoming release, in addition to the exciting news that
Ghost Walking/ Waltz and The New Manson Family
have been re-released on CD.
